This first gallery shows how I used a canvas print. I had a clearance picture that had a solid wood surface. Because I didn’t want to put the print behind glass, I decided I would make this work. I had another canvas print, but I didn’t want two pictures. You will see what I did with the second canvas print in the second photo gallery. These projects are pretty straightforward.

I did have to cut down both pictures, one to fit the frame and one to fit the box I was using. After cutting them to size, I applied “Yes” glue (The only one I use for this kind of project. I do dilute it with a little water) to the front of the piece I’m working on.

I placed the canvas where I wanted it on each surface and then continued to smooth out the bubbles. That’s it. The first picture is the one I covered with the white pumpkin print.
